5 things you must know about Spray Adhesives

If you need to make something stick perfectly and quickly, choosing a spray adhesive is a better option than the other types of adhesives. So here are 5 things that you must be knowing about Spray Adhesives.

 

1. The Connection

The most important thing to keep in mind before using a spray adhesive is to be sure that the spray gun, the hose, and the canister are connected correctly. Following are the steps involved in doing so:

  • Screw the larger nut of the hose to the gun thread, clockwise, and then fully tighten it using a wrench.
  • Now screw the smaller nut of the hose to the canister, clockwise, and then tighten this using the wrench again.
  • Turn on the valve placed on the canister, until it is fully open.

 

 

2. The Maintenance

You have to maintain the spraying gun, hose, and the canister properly after every use so that it lasts long. Check the spray tip regularly, because sometimes it may get clogged and damaged, which will cause poor spray performance. So, try to clean the tip after every use if you do not want to change it every time.

 

3. The Ideal Spray Conditions

The conditions in which you use the spray adhesive plays an important role in how strong the spray adhesives will act. The warmer and drier the air is, the quicker the glue will dry. It is also especially important that the surface where the adhesive is to be sprayed is cleaned thoroughly.

 

4. The Ideal Spray Pattern

Spraying adhesive should not be considered as a play and should be done properly in the correct pattern because the spray has to be exactly right, neither too heavy nor too light.

 

5. The Disconnection and Disposal

It is even more important than how you disconnect and dispose the spray gun, canister, and the hose. Following are the steps to do so: -

  • Turn the valve on the canister off, by turning it in a counter-clockwise direction.
  • Pull the trigger of the gun on for few seconds to expel out the residual pressure.
  • Unscrew all the nuts.

Different Types of Adhesives Used in Industrial Applications

An adhesive can be described as a substance that is used for holding objects or material together. There are many types of adhesives available in the market based on their effectiveness and composition to hold the elements together. Resins, Spray Adhesive, hot melt adhesive, acrylic adhesive, anaerobic adhesive, conductive adhesive, epoxy adhesive and pressure adhesive are some of its types. Below mentioned are the various types of adhesives available in the market and their uses: -

● Resins are one of the most popular options available when it comes to adhesives. They are essentially polymers of synthetic origin and can either be thermostatic or thermosetting; i.e. it is possible to remodel them at high temperatures, or they can’t be remoulded after the curing process has completed.



● Hot melt adhesives can be hardened or softened whenever required. They have excellent bonding quality and can bond very fast to the material once it's heated.

Spray Adhesive is ideal to be used on uneven and porous surfaces as well because it's waterproof and stain-proof. Also, spray adhesives are environment-friendly as no chlorinated agent is present.

● Acrylic adhesives need more time to set as it incorporates a unique mechanism that requires 2 individual components to be mixed together, thereby creating the bonding.

● When tight seals without the use of heat, oxygen or light are required, then Anaerobic adhesives are the best option available.

● Pressure adhesives are popularly used as industrial adhesives as they require pressure to bond different surfaces.

Adhesives are often required in articles those components cannot be bound together by using nails, screws or other types of hardware tools. Adhesives provide support to the components to stay in place. Spray Adhesives are generally used in furniture but have ample of applications as it provides both temporary and permanent sticking.
